Ryanair reverses planned growth on select Croatia routes

Ryanair has this week updated its upcoming 2026 summer schedule, cutting close to forty weekly flights from its Croatian network in April and a further 24 weekly rotations in May. The airline has also reduced its peak-summer flights from the country by nine weekly services. The cuts for April and May primarily affect Zadar.
